In the current environmentally conscious society, what to do with obsolete computer equipment becomes a major concern. Businesses have paid the price in terms of additional costs for proper disposal, regulatory fines, unfavorable publicity and even litigation when PC’s turned up in landfills, third-world countries or when confidential or sensitive data was recovered from hard drives that were not properly sanitized. Some companies have been assessed with heavy fines for disposal deemed “environmentally unsafe” and paid again when the disposal providers they partnered with collected their payment and then dumped the equipment. Businesses must clearly understand and carefully assess disposal alternatives against the growing risk of liability.

FIVE COMMON DISPOSAL MISTAKES:

The five (5) most common mistakes businesses make when disposing of electronic equipment:

1) Residual Confidential Data on Computers
2) Illegal Disposal
3) No Transfer of Title
4) Illegal Resale of Software
5) Hidden Costs (Storage, Security, Taxes and Insurance)
